Who Should You Test With?
You should always test with people who are in your target audience. This ensures that you’re getting accurate feedback about your product or service.
If you’re not sure who your target audience is, you can use market research to figure it out. Once you know who you’re targeting, you can start testing with them.
There are a few different ways to test with your target audience. You can use surveys, interviews, or focus groups. Each method has its own advantages and disadvantages, so you’ll need to decide which one is right for you.
Surveys are a good option if you want to reach a large number of people quickly. However, they can be expensive, and you may not get as much detailed information as you would with other methods.
Interviews are a good way to get in-depth information from your target audience. However, they can be time-consuming, and you may only be able to reach a small number of people.
Focus groups are a good option if you want to get detailed feedback from a group of people. However, they can be expensive, and you may not be able to reach a large number of people.
No matter which method you choose, make sure you’re clear about what you want to learn from your target audience. This will help you design your questions and get the most useful information from your tests.

How Many People Should You Test With?
The number of people you test with really depends on what you’re trying to test. If you’re trying to test something small, like a change to a button, you might only need to test with 5-10 people. But if you’re testing something bigger, like a new feature on your website, you might need to test with 50-100 people.
The best way to figure out how many people to test with is to start small and then increase the number of people if you need to. That way you’re not wasting time and money testing with more people than you need to.
So, to answer your question, there is no set number of people that you should test with. It all depends on your specific situation.

How Can You Ensure You’re Testing With The Right People?
There are a few key things to keep in mind when you’re testing with people. First, you want to make sure that you’re testing with people who are actually representative of your target audience. This means considering factors like age, gender, location, and interests.
Second, you want to make sure that you’re testing with people who are willing and able to give you honest feedback. This means finding people who are not already familiar with your product or service, and who are willing to take the time to try it out and give you their honest opinion.
Finally, you want to make sure that you’re not testing with too few people. While it’s important to get feedback from a variety of people, you also need to make sure that you have a large enough sample size to be able to draw meaningful conclusions from your data.
By keeping these things in mind, you can be sure that you’re testing with the right people and that you’re getting the most accurate and helpful feedback possible.

What Are Some Common Testing Mistakes?
1. Failing to Define the Scope of the Test
When you’re testing, it’s important to know what you’re testing for. This means having a clear understanding of the goals of the test, and what you need to do to achieve them. Without a clear understanding of the scope of the test, you’re likely to make mistakes that can lead to inaccurate results.
2. Not Creating a Test Plan
A test plan is a document that outlines the details of a test, including its objectives, scope, methodology, and schedule. Without a test plan, it’s easy to forget important details or to make changes to the test without properly documenting them. This can lead to problems when you’re trying to analyze the results of the test.
3. Testing Without Following the Testing Plan
Once you’ve created a test plan, it’s important to follow it. This means sticking to the schedule, methodology, and objectives that you’ve outlined. If you deviate from the plan, it can be difficult to compare the results of the test to the goals that you originally set out to achieve.
4. Not Documenting the Results
It’s important to document the results of your tests, including any bugs that you find. This documentation can be used to help improve the product or process that you’re testing. Without documentation, it can be difficult to track the progress of your testing, or to identify areas that need improvement.
5. Failing to Analyze the Results
After you’ve completed a test and documented the results, it’s important to take the time to analyze the data. This analysis can help you to identify areas of improvement, and to make decisions about future tests. Without analysis, it can be difficult to make the most of your testing efforts.
